Sažetak
Tourism entrepreneurship in the context of Central and Eastern European countries has received little attention from scholars. We believe that further research is required in order to deepen understanding and to challenge established Western views on the subject. In this paper we analyse the business environment in former socialist economy Croatia and consequent entrepreneurial strategies undertaken. Findings suggest that besides high barriers to entry, historical legacies still affect the population’s mentality towards entrepreneurs. In order to survive in such environment, hotel industry entrepreneurs undertake specific strategies which compensate for underdeveloped market institutions. The adopted research approach, which takes into account the context in which entrepreneurs operate, demonstrates that Western economies concepts do not have strong resonance in former socialist economies.
